Highvelder aims to sell 2 000 cupcakes for children with cancer

To reach our target, the Highvelder need the help of avid bakers to bake and donate cupcakes.

ERMELO – For Childhood Cancer Awareness Month, Highvelder aims to sell 2 000 cupcakes on September 28 at the Highvelder offices at 43 Kerk Street.

We will once again partner with Cupcakes of Hope to host the fundraising event in honour of children fighting cancer.

With a target of 2 000 cupcakes, we need the community’s help to make a difference.

The newspaper invites any avid bakers who wish to make a donation to bake 12 or 24 cupcakes, to hand these in at the offices on September 27.

The cupcakes will be sold at R5 each, however, any donations are welcome.

All proceeds will go to Cupcakes of Hope.
